The Nigerian Economic Summit Group (NESG) is Nigeria’s foremost private sector-led think-tank and policy advocacy institution. At the NESG, our work in providing fact-based advocacy has allowed us to prioritize and use our voice to encourage different actors to come together to dialogue on critical socio-economic issues. Only through conversations, interventions, and innovation will we change the landscape in Nigeria and across Africa. Nevertheless, only a well-informed and united people make a great nation. Assessment Of The Impact Of Covid-19 Lockdown On Households In Nigeria 23.03.2021

During the first wave of the COVID-19 pandemic, the pioneer NESG Bridge Fellows carried out a survey of the assessment of the impact of the Covid-19 lockdown on the economic, social, health, educational, and psychological wellbeing of members of households in Nigeria. Why Is Women Empowerment Important? 12.03.2021

International Women's Day is a global day celebrating the social, economic, cultural and political achievements of women. The day also marks a call to action for accelerating gender parity. Significant activity is witnessed worldwide as groups come together to celebrate women's achievements or rally for women's equality. This year's international women's day theme is #ChoosetoChallenge.
